Overclocking CPU via Bios?

Change the multiplier to something reasonable, don't put it to the max just to see if it can. Look at what other people average on the cpu. Test to see if the CPU is stable, if not, then slowly back off in slow increments maybe 1 or 0.5, until it's stable. Avoid touching voltages if you can.
